About Madsudanpur Devidas

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Madsudanpur Devidas village is 111881. Madsudanpur Devidas village is located in Najibabad tehsil of Bijnor district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 23km away from sub-district headquarter Najibabad (tehsildar office) and 23km away from district headquarter Bijnor. As per 2009 stats, Isalmpur Sahu is the gram panchayat of Madsudanpur Devidas village.

The total geographical area of village is 117.09 hectares. Madsudanpur Devidas has a total population of 386 peoples, out of which male population is 207 while female population is 179. Literacy rate of madsudanpur devidas village is 72.80% out of which 78.74% males and 65.92% females are literate. There are about 66 houses in madsudanpur devidas village.

Bijnor is nearest town to madsudanpur devidas for all major economic activities, which is approximately 5km away.
